C/C++开发主要学习哪些内容
来源:东莞达内IT教育培训学校时间:2022/4/11 18:12:01
C/C++开发主要学习哪些内容?C++是世界上较复杂的编程语言,它较初定位为C语言的升级版,之后又增加了大量语法特性,但这并不意味着我们要把它学得那么复杂。
主要掌握的知识点是:
基础语法:变量、条件、循环、字符串、数组、函数
指针操作、内存管理:这两项是C++的灵魂,是这门语言经久不衰的关键,但这也是一把双刃剑,用的好可以极大提高程序运行的速率,用不好会导致内存泄漏甚至程序崩溃
面向对象编程:类的定义与使用,继承与派生,这项特性增加了代码良好的复用和封装,是大型项目开发的必备因素
掌握编程语言后,就要跟操作系统打交道了。
应用实践
Windows和Linux是操作系统的两大阵营,大家可以根据自己的需求进行选择。
在Windows下编程的可以跳过这个部分,因为Visual Studio(Community社区版)功能已经足够强大,不需要进行任何配置上手即用,关键还是0元的!这里说一声微软牛。
这部分主要掌握的知识点是:
操作系统下软件的编译与执行:编译器、makefile
常用的系统调用:system,getenv等
软件设计
软件设计中,算法与数据结构、计算机网络、操作系统,是计算机考研必备的三门课程,也是整个计算机的基石。修炼好这三部分知识的程序员就像掌握了深厚的内功,无论是学习其他语言还是算法,都会更加得心应手,事半功倍。
尊重原创文章,转载请注明出处与链接:http://www.peixun360.com/2304/news/511783/违者必究!
以上就是东莞达内IT教育培训学校 小编为您整理 C/C++开发主要学习哪些内容的全部内容。